Research Abstract

Water quality management system based on characteristics of industrial processes, their location and water environment is necessary to reduce loading of pollutants into water bodies and to protect and improve water environment. The purpose of this study is to develop on integrated system of water treatment system, procuction systen and water use system taking characteristic features of each industry. Specific purposes were 1) development of crireeia on the choice of separate treatment of wastewaters on-site or improvement of combined treatment of wastewaters to reduce total discharge, 2) evaluation of conventional, carbon, nitrogen and phosphorus removal processes for wastewaters from various industries, 3) possibility of elosed processing and alternative processes to minimize loading, and 4) effects of energy and materials savings on pollution loading.
We focused our sttention to pollution loading from different industries. Comprehensive survey on pollution discharges from various industries were carried out to clarify the difference between the size and location of industries and analyzed the cause of discharge. Survey points are 1) size, distribution, location of industries, 2) existing wastewater treatment and wastewater management systems of industries as a function of size, and 3) characterization of wastewater quality. Surveys were carried out by census and field surveys. Based on surveys, studies on wastewater and water treatment technologies ans water reuse system were carried out. Zero emission process for pollution loads to protect water environment based on wastewater treatment and reuse system were discussed.
